The 200g vinyl is heavy - noticeably heavier than your run o' the mill album.
If you have the 200g version you would know. As for differences - besides the
weight. Well...the 200g version was released in 2003 and more than likely was
mastered specifically for this release. I did read on a music board (not this
one) that Bernie Grundman (google him) mastered both the original album release
and this 2003 re-release. Is this 2003 release "better"? Well...for my ears
the 2003 vinyl release is WAY better than the CD version. I do have a copy of
the original vinyl release around. I will run that through and see/hear how it
